Profile

A right-arm fast bowler, Shafiul Islam had an impressive debut in 2007 for the Rajshahi Division as he bowled a terrific spell, taking five wickets. The right-arm pacer showed promising signs with the new ball and caught the selectors' eye. An untimely injury to senior bowler Mashrafe Mortaza earned him a national call-up.

Shafiul was included in the ODI squad for the 2010 home Tri-series against India and Sri Lanka. He made his ODI debut against Sri Lanka, while his Test debut came against India in the same series. Later, in the 2011 ICC Cricket World Cup, Shafiul impressed with his lower-order batting that helped Bangladesh clinch a thriller over England.
